[dpdk-dev,v3] doc/guides: add info on how to enable QAT

Message ID 1473775738-142704-1-git-send-email-deepak.k.jain@intel.com (mailing list archive)
State Accepted, archived
Delegated to: Pablo de Lara Guarch
Headers

Commit Message

Deepak Kumar JAIN Sept. 13, 2016, 2:08 p.m. UTC
  From: Eoin Breen <eoin.breen@intel.com>

Signed-off-by: Eoin Breen <eoin.breen@intel.com>
Signed-off-by: Deepak Kumar Jain <deepak.k.jain@intel.com>
---
Changes in v3:
* Add console code-block
* Modified the command to replace n with y in build/.config

Changes in v2:
* Incorporated comments received on v1.


 doc/guides/cryptodevs/qat.rst | 11 +++++++++++
 1 file changed, 11 insertions(+)
  

Comments

Fiona Trahe Sept. 15, 2016, 2:34 p.m. UTC | #1
> -----Original Message-----
> From: dev [mailto:dev-bounces@dpdk.org] On Behalf Of Deepak Kumar Jain
> Sent: Tuesday, September 13, 2016 3:09 PM
> To: dev@dpdk.org
> Cc: De Lara Guarch, Pablo <pablo.de.lara.guarch@intel.com>; Breen, Eoin
> <eoin.breen@intel.com>; Jain, Deepak K <deepak.k.jain@intel.com>
> Subject: [dpdk-dev] [PATCH v3] doc/guides: add info on how to enable QAT
> 
> From: Eoin Breen <eoin.breen@intel.com>
> 
> Signed-off-by: Eoin Breen <eoin.breen@intel.com>
> Signed-off-by: Deepak Kumar Jain <deepak.k.jain@intel.com>
Acked-by: Fiona Trahe <fiona.trahe@intel.com>
  
De Lara Guarch, Pablo Sept. 17, 2016, 1:50 a.m. UTC | #2
> -----Original Message-----
> From: Jain, Deepak K
> Sent: Tuesday, September 13, 2016 7:09 AM
> To: dev@dpdk.org
> Cc: De Lara Guarch, Pablo; Breen, Eoin; Jain, Deepak K
> Subject: [PATCH v3] doc/guides: add info on how to enable QAT
> 
> From: Eoin Breen <eoin.breen@intel.com>
> 
> Signed-off-by: Eoin Breen <eoin.breen@intel.com>
> Signed-off-by: Deepak Kumar Jain <deepak.k.jain@intel.com>
> ---

Applied to dpdk-next-crypto.
Thanks,

Pablo
  

Patch

diff --git a/doc/guides/cryptodevs/qat.rst b/doc/guides/cryptodevs/qat.rst
index 3ee2312..2480ce2 100644
--- a/doc/guides/cryptodevs/qat.rst
+++ b/doc/guides/cryptodevs/qat.rst
@@ -83,6 +83,17 @@  Installation
 To use the DPDK QAT PMD an SRIOV-enabled QAT kernel driver is required. The
 VF devices exposed by this driver will be used by QAT PMD.
 
+To enable QAT in DPDK, follow the instructions mentioned in
+http://dpdk.org/doc/guides/linux_gsg/build_dpdk.html
+
+Quick instructions as follows:
+
+.. code-block:: console
+
+	make config T=x86_64-native-linuxapp-gcc
+	sed -i 's,\(CONFIG_RTE_LIBRTE_PMD_QAT\)=n,\1=y,' build/.config
+	make
+
 If you are running on kernel 4.4 or greater, see instructions for
 `Installation using kernel.org driver`_ below. If you are on a kernel earlier
 than 4.4, see `Installation using 01.org QAT driver`_.